John Sisk & Son is a construction and engineering contractor operating across Ireland, the United Kingdom, and Europe. It delivers buildings and infrastructure in sectors including life sciences, data centers, healthcare, commercial property, transport, and public works. The company works with clients from preconstruction and design coordination through construction, fit-out, and project handover. Its operating model combines engineering, project controls, procurement, supply-chain management, digital construction, safety, and field delivery. Roles include engineers, surveyors, planners, project managers, skilled trades, commercial teams, and corporate functions.
